Water filtration systems for sub-surface drip irrigation
It is an irrigation system that uses a main network to distribute the filtered and pressurized water to the emitting pipes under the surface of the terrain and together the crop line. The emitters in line supply a unique flow rate by each emitting point that is among the interval of 0,6-8l/h. The volume of water supplied under the surface of the soil (nearest the plants) generates a spatial distribution of the same named “dump bulb”. Water filtration systems for sub-surface drip irrigation - 2
Subsurface drip Irrigation Systems (SDI) are a suitable agronomic option for all type of crops: woody crops (almond tree, vineyard, olive tree, pistachio tree, peach tree, etc.) and extensive crops (corn, vetch, barley, alfalfa, etc.). The SDI is an irrigation technique that allows the supply of water and nutrients in a localized way under the surface.
